> 1- when i shut down, a window quickly pops up and goes again does this
> mean
> something is still open? maybe in missus account?


What does it say? It might be a running program or service that won't shut
down normally, which Windows kills.

> 2- how to delete all songs in media center all at once.? (600) (want to
> start again caus didnt edit songs before media center copied them and they
> are all over the place takes too long edit 1 by 1)


Open your Windows Media Player music library. Mark all songs/albums/artists
and hit delete. In the dialog box that appears, chose 'delete from from
library and computer'.

> the window is too quick too read but it looks all black.


You may be able to find information about what happened in Control Panel >
System > Administrative Tools > Event viewer (event list). You could take a
look at Control Panel > System > Problem reports and solutions (problems
log) as well, just to see if something has been reported.
